`
hanqunfeng
  • 浏览: 1527307 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

hudson--部署设置

阅读更多

需要为hudson安装Deploy to container Plugin插件。安装完成后,job设置Post-build Actions中会找到Deploy war/ear to a container配置项,勾选上。

 

该插件只支持war包或ear包的部署。

 

具体配置如下:

WAR/EAR files:war或ear文件的路径,这个路径是相对于JOB_WORKSPACE的。注意:如果是第一次构建,hudsno会提示你路径不存在,原因就是war包还没有创建,如果是这样,可以不用管它,保存即可。

Container:选择使用的容器

Manager user name:容器管理员,如果使用的是tomcat,可以参考tomcat管理账号配置

Manager password:密码

XXX URL:容器访问路径,hudson支持跨服务器部署,所以该路径可以与hudson不在同一台服务器。(个人认为,这是hudson比较强大的地方)

 

ok,这样就配置完成了。执行构建时会将指定的包部署到指定的服务器中。比如tomcat,就是部署到其webapps中。

 

分享到:
评论
6 楼 zkx1217 2013-08-27  
zkx1217 写道
你好,问下,我在Ubuntu 下面配置自动发布到tomcat,没有发布过去。

但在windows下面是可以的, 这两者之间部署这块配置还有啥区别吗?

问题已解决,谢谢
5 楼 zkx1217 2013-08-27  
你好,问下,我在Ubuntu 下面配置自动发布到tomcat,没有发布过去。

但在windows下面是可以的, 这两者之间部署这块配置还有啥区别吗?
4 楼 paulwong 2012-01-31  
XXX URL 具体该怎么写?例如如果是JBOSS的话.
3 楼 hanqunfeng 2011-12-30  
fengzhiyin 写道
haohaoxuexi1311 写道
你好,我尝试着用你这种方法。
插件已经下载安装好了~
也照你的配置弄好了
但是tomcat下webapps始终没有.war ? 求解决。谢谢了

同求

不是你是否使用ant或maven来生成war包?hudson只是负责将你指定的war包部署到tomcat中
2 楼 fengzhiyin 2011-12-29  
haohaoxuexi1311 写道
你好,我尝试着用你这种方法。
插件已经下载安装好了~
也照你的配置弄好了
但是tomcat下webapps始终没有.war ? 求解决。谢谢了

同求
1 楼 haohaoxuexi1311 2011-10-08  
你好,我尝试着用你这种方法。
插件已经下载安装好了~
也照你的配置弄好了
但是tomcat下webapps始终没有.war ? 求解决。谢谢了

相关推荐

    hudson-3.1.0.war

    •易于安装-只要把hudson.war部署到servlet容器,不需要数据库支持。 •易于配置-所有配置都是通过其提供的web界面实现。 •集成RSS/E-mail/IM-通过RSS发布构建结果或当构建失败时通过e-mail实时通知。 •生成...

    hudson+sonar自动部署配置

    hudson+sonar自动部署配置,讲解很基础很详细~

    centos环境hudson自动化部署报告.doc

    centos环境hudson自动化部署报告.doc

    hudson 使用说明

    Hudson 最吸引人的特性之一是它很容易配置:很难找到更容易设置的 CI 服务器,也很难找到开箱即用特性如此丰富的CI 服务器。Hudson 容易使用的第二个原因是它具有强大的插件框架 ,所以很容易添加特性。例如,一个 ...

    hudson自动化部署配置

    Hudson是一款可扩展的持续集成(Continuous Integration)引擎。 1.1 主要作用: (1)自动化地构建软件项目。 (2)构建可持续的自动化检查 (3)构建可持续的自动化测试 (4)构建成功后,后续过程的自动化...

    hudson3下载,持续集成工具,java项目自动发布部署工具

    hudson下载,放在tomcat下运行,或持续集成工具的安装包,java项目自动发布部署工具包。配置jdk,cvs或svn或git,配置maven等,可自动拉取服务器代码,自动编译代码,自动发布代码。非常好用的自动发布集成工具。

    jenkins hudson 插件开发部署外带一个小实例

    详细介绍了jenkins(hudson)的插件开发部署,指导你如何去开发一个插件,虽然里面那个插件没什么实际功能,但是有效果,能看到效果,这样你就可以了解到这个开发到底是怎么一回事,字面还带了一些资料,适合新手看看...

    Hudson持续集成

    •易于安装-只要把hudson.war部署到servlet容器,不需要数据库支持。 •易于配置-所有配置都是通过其提供的web界面实现。 •集成RSS/E-mail/IM-通过RSS发布构建结果或当构建失败时通过e-mail实时通知。 •生成...

    hudson+maven+svn的简单自动化部署,目前本人已经使用在现网了

    hudson+maven+svn的简单自动化部署,目前本人已经使用在现网了、简单实用。已经说明所有步骤,看着练习就可以使用发布了

    Hudson安装配置,和远程布置

    资源为Hudson安装压缩包和安装配置文档,包含远程部署到服务器上。或者直接安装到服务器

    Hudson持续集成实战

    Hudson持续集成实战 自动化部署教程

    hudson 使用手册

     1、易于安装-只要把hudson.war部署到servlet容器,不需要数据库支持。 2、易于配置-所有配置都是通过其提供的web界面实现。 3、集成RSS/E-mail/IM-通过RSS发布构建结果或当构建失败时通过e-mail实时通知。 4、生成...

    hudson+maven+svn自动化部署

    工作目的:实现自动化部署工作,以期提高开发项目的工作效率; 工作内容:利用开源的可持续集成工具,实现java项目的自动编译、打包、发布等工作流程;...三、 Hudson对web项目实现自动化的编译、打包与发布;

    Hudson+Maven+SVN 自动部署

    NULL 博文链接:https://a601167866.iteye.com/blog/1561410

    Hudson持续集成工具-其他

    1、易于安装-只要把hudson.war部署到servlet容器,不需要数据库支持。 2、易于配置-所有配置都是通过其提供的web界面实现。 3、集成RSS/E-mail/IM-通过RSS发布构建结果或当构建失败时通过e-mail实时通知。 4、生成...

    Hudson配置手册完美教程

    Hudson配置手册完美教程,实现自动化部署,轻松搞定,欢迎大家学习。

    Linux 安装hudson+maven+nexus

    Linux中安装hudson,并实现自动化部署

    hudson操作说明

    hudson操作说明,包括安装部署以及自动部署。

    hudson配置图解

    hudson配置图解,热部署。本人已测试通过

Global site tag (gtag.js) - Google Analytics